Why is there no option -U with pg_dump?

when i call psql i can connect as another user and i usually dont
need a password because i trust all local users via hba.conf, right?

thats the way it works on my host. but why cant i connect via pg_dump?
i need this because every devolper gets his own database and
sometimes a developer wants to mirror the production database. i
tried to write a little shell script which drops and recreates your
user databse and then uses the dump of the production database to
create schema and fill teh rows. useful option is --no-owner to
supress the connect statements.

But i cant connect without user input. because the option -U ask for
username and password.

Any workaround or suggestions?
